I had numerous request to do a Necronomicon, and to make a larger box. So I was inspired to do both in one. Below are some pics of the WIP and how things are shaping up. I hope to have everything finished up and a painted copy done over the weekend.

Here is the book base I made and the mold that was made from it. I plan to use this base to make various other styles of book type boxes. I created this using balsa wood and apoxie.
Spoiler Alert!


This is the Necronomicon so far. I lightly glued some balsa wood as a base on the back, spine, and cover. On that balsa wood I then spread out some apoxie clays and shaped it into the necronmicon as you see it so far. After everything is shaped and dried to my satisfaction I will pull off the balsa wood with the clay attached and mold those pieces.

Working on a lot of new stuff. This is a Rage demon Encounter for a series of 12 encounters I have planned. The next encounter will involve a wild mage that allows you to draw from a deck of random wild mage effects that can be good or bad for you. To get rid of the bad ones you will have to kill the mage, but he is tricky and will teleport to 6 random locations on the map. If he dies some of the good effects can cause a negative effect so keeping him alive is vital to those players that got lucky with there draw.

Also stay tuned for a steampunk deck box coming soon that has a life counter on the top that will count to 100 life.



Here are the Cards text for the Rage Demon Encounter

RAGE DEMON ENCOUNTER

At the end of each players turn if a Rage Demon is not in play or on another figures army card then roll a 20-sided die. If you roll a 16 or higher then place the Rage Demon figure on the center hex of the Summoning Circle. If another figure is already on the center hex of the Summoning Circle then the Rage Demon has been killed by the figure occupying the center hex.

SUMMONING SPIRES
Subtract 1 from the dice roll when rolling for the Rage Demon Encounter for each spire that has been destroyed

Here is the Rage Demon Text
RAGE BLAST
SPECIAL ATTACK
Range 7. Attack 3.
After each players turn Rage Demon will attack every figure with in range and clear line of sight using Special Attack Rage Blast.

ENDLESS RAGE
If Rage Demon is killed by another figure or squad then place it on that figure or squads Army card. That figure or squad then adds adds 1 to the attack number on their army card.

The red stuff is the begining of some more marro terrain

The texture on the ruins was made by flocking some small rocks on, and using slate for texture.

The dwarven mine, and the cave are both hollow inside the walls about 1/4 inch thick. The mine has about 4 lbs of apoxie on it. The cave about 3..
